With HECO-TOPIX-plus CC, HECO offers an efficient solution for connecting main and secondary beams. The specially developed fully threaded screw enables gap-free, deformation-resistant connections in just one step.
Whether in new construction, renovation, or timber engineering, stable main/secondary beam connections are crucial for the load-bearing capacity of modern timber structures. The HECO-TOPIX-plus CombiConnect was specially developed for the safe transfer of high tensile and compressive forces and, thanks to its coordinated double thread, ensures an active pulling-together effect. This means that components are fixed to the shear joint in a force-fit manner and permanently connected without gaps. The screw is available in diameters of 6.5 and 8.5 mm and in lengths from 100 to 350 mm and has a certificate of usability (ETA-19/0553). A screw-in angle of 45 degrees ensures maximum stability, while the proven HECO-TOPIX-plus tip generally eliminates the need for pre-drilling and reduces the risk of wood cracks. As part of a comprehensive system solution including installation aids, dimensioning software, BIM/CAD data, and technical advice, HECO supports planners and users in the safe and economical implementation of timber construction.
